[sql] 문자열 변환 함수 (UPPER, LOWER, TRIM 등)

SQL에서는 문자열을 다양한 방식으로 변환할 수 있는 함수를 제공합니다. 이러한 함수를 사용하면 데이터를 쿼리하거나 결과를 표시할 때 문자열을 일관된 형식으로 표시할 수 있습니다. 여기서는 주요 문자열 변환 함수인 UPPER, LOWER, TRIM 함수에 대해 알아보겠습니다.

UPPER 함수

UPPER 함수는 문자열을 모두 대문자로 변환합니다.

예시:

SELECT UPPER('hello world') AS upper_string;

결과:

UPPER_STRING
-------------
HELLO WORLD

LOWER 함수

LOWER 함수는 문자열을 모두 소문자로 변환합니다.

예시:

SELECT LOWER('Hello World') AS lower_string;

결과:

LOWER_STRING
-------------
hello world

TRIM 함수

TRIM 함수는 문자열의 앞뒤에 있는 공백을 제거합니다.

예시:

SELECT TRIM('   hello world   ') AS trimmed_string;

결과:

TRIMMED_STRING
-------------
hello world

위의 함수들은 데이터를 조회하거나 결과를 표시할 때 필요한 형식으로 문자열을 변환할 수 있는데 유용하게 사용됩니다.

더 많은 문자열 변환 함수와 사용 예제에 대해서는 SQL 문서나 관련 레퍼런스를 참고하세요.

위의 예제는 MySQL을 기준으로 작성되었습니다.

MySQL 공식 문서


본 문서는 SQL의 문자열 변환 함수에 대한 설명입니다.